There's really not much advice to be given. Knock out the hobgobs. Frenzy anyone you can into the crowd.
And especially, when on defence, watch out fot the CD teams ability to quickly change their direction of commitment. If you commit your dwarves too much to one side, you will find her cd's on the other side of the pitch next turn.
